Acta Cryst. (2005). E61, o2086-o2088 [ doi:10.1107/S1600536805017939 ]
Abstract: The title compound, C44H42N4O5S, was synthesized by the intermolecular [3+2] cycloaddition of an azomethine ylide, derived from isatin and sarcosine by a decarboxylative route, and 5-(4-methoxyphenyl-10-(4-methoxy)benzylidene-2-(4-methoxy)benzylidene-2,3,6,7,8,9-hexahydro-5H,10H-cyclohepta[1,2-d]thiazolo[3,2-a]pyrimidin-3-one. In the molecule, the two spiro junctions link a planar 2-oxindole ring, a pyrrolidine ring in an envelope conformation and a 10-(arylmethylene)hexahydrocyclohepta[1,2-d]thiazolo[3,2-a]pyrimidin-3-one ring. The packing of the molecules in the crystal structure is mainly governed by N-H
N hydrogen bonds.
